Abstract

R E T R A C T E D: We, the Editors and Publisher of the EAI Computing and Communication in Emerging Regions - CCER, are retracting the following article:

Saputra, F.E., Hadi, E.D., & Hayadi, I. (2021). Pros and Cons of Robot, Artificial Intelligence, and Service Automation (RAISA) Technologies to be Adopted and Implemented in Service Industries. In: P Parwito, P Praningrum, M. Y. I. Daulay, & R. Rahim (Eds.), Proceedings of the 3rd Beehive International Social Innovation Conference, BISIC 2020, 3-4 October 2020, Bengkulu, Indonesia. Ghent, Belgium: European Alliancefor Innovation. DOI: 10.4108/eai.3-10-2020.2306597.

We are now cognizant of similar content of this article, which was published in, Robots, Artificial Intelligence and Service Automation in Travel, Tourism and Hospitality: Ivanov, S., & Webster, C. (2019). Conceptual Framework of the Use of Robots, Artificial Intelligence and Service Automation in Travel, Tourism, and Hospitality Companies. In Ivanov, S., & Webster, C. (Eds.) (2019). Robots, Artificial Intelligence and Service Automation in Travel, Tourism and Hospitality (pp. 7-37). Emerald Publishing. https://doi.org/10.1108/978-1-78756-687-320191001.

A preview of the retracted article will remain online to maintain the scholarly record, but it is digitally watermarked as R E T R A C T E D.
